有沒有一瞬間,在開啟docker或打開虛擬機時,內(nèi)存瞬間飚增,進(jìn)行查看進(jìn)程消耗是一個Vmmem的進(jìn)程在作祟,那么Vmmem是什么呢,又如何進(jìn)行限制呢!
Vmmem:是一個系統(tǒng)合成的虛擬進(jìn)程,用于表示虛擬機小航的內(nèi)存和CPU資源。換句話說,您看到的Vmmem消耗大量內(nèi)存和CPU資源,也就意味著虛擬機正在消耗大量的內(nèi)存和CPU資源,如果要讓它停止,請關(guān)閉您的虛擬機。
上面是對官方對Vmmem的解釋,當(dāng)然,我們既然打開了虛擬機,肯定是需要使用的,關(guān)閉是不可能關(guān)閉的,只能去限制其使用的大內(nèi)存:以下是限制Vmmem占用內(nèi)存的方法。
限制前浮動在20%左右,這是限制后的:
#.wslconfig
[wsl2]
memory=3GB?//分配給WSL內(nèi)存3GB
swap=4GB ??//設(shè)置交換分區(qū)4GB
localhostForwarding=true
四、運行PowerShell執(zhí)行wsl --shutdown命令,執(zhí)行成功后,即可看到我們的Vmmem的占用明顯降低。附:WSL中的高級設(shè)置配置鏈接:https://learn.microsoft.com/en-us/windows/wsl/wsl-config#configure-global-options-with-wslconfig
你是否還在尋找穩(wěn)定的海外服務(wù)器提供商?創(chuàng)新互聯(lián)www.cdcxhl.cn海外機房具備T級流量清洗系統(tǒng)配攻擊溯源,準(zhǔn)確流量調(diào)度確保服務(wù)器高可用性,企業(yè)級服務(wù)器適合批量采購,新人活動首月15元起,快前往官網(wǎng)查看詳情吧